Common Window Issues
-
Drafts and Air Leaks
- Drafts are a typical issue that can significantly impact energy effectiveness. They occur when air leakages through spaces in the window frame or around the window itself. This can result in increased cooling and heating costs and make the interior of the building less comfortable.
-
Water Leaks
- Water leakages can trigger damage to the window frame, walls, and even the foundation of a building. They frequently result from bad installation, damaged seals, or damaged weatherstripping.
-
Broken Glass
- Damaged glass is a safety threat and can compromise the security of a building. It can also cause energy loss and discomfort due to drafts and noise.
-
Sticking or Jammed Windows
- Sticking or jammed windows can be frustrating and can also indicate underlying concerns such as warping or damage to the window frame. This can make it difficult to open and close windows, impacting ventilation and emergency situation escape routes.
-
Foggy or Condensation Between Panes
- Foggy or condensation between the panes of a double Glazing Repairs near me-pane window is an indication that the seal has stopped working. This can reduce the window’s insulating properties and make it less reliable at maintaining a comfy temperature.

Frequently asked questions
Q: How often should I have my windows examined for maintenance?
- A: It is advised to have your windows examined at least when a year. This can assist identify and address issues before they end up being more serious and expensive to repair.
Q: Can I repair my windows myself, or should I employ an expert?

- A: While some minor issues can be resolved with DIY services, it is normally best to employ an expert for more complex repairs. Experts have the know-how and tools to ensure that the repair is done properly and securely.
Q: What should I do if I notice a draft coming from my windows?
- A: If you observe a draft, you can begin by inspecting the seals and weatherstripping around the window. If these are worn out or harmed, they can be replaced. Nevertheless, if the issue continues, it might be time to call an expert for a more extensive inspection.
Q: How can I prevent water leaks around my windows?
- A: To avoid water leakages, guarantee that the seals and weatherstripping remain in great condition. Regularly tidy the window tracks and apply a sealant around the window frame to develop a water tight barrier.
Q: Is it more cost-efficient to repair or replace broken windows?
- A: In numerous cases, repairing damaged windows is more cost-effective than changing them. However, if the windows are old or severely damaged, replacement may be the much better option. A specialist can help you figure out the most economical service.
